Salt Composition

Cefixime (200mg) + Ofloxacin (200mg)

Overview Bdxime-O Tablet

Combiflox-O tablets are a dual-action antibiotic combating diverse bacterial infections. This prescription medication inhibits microbial proliferation, curbing infection spread. Adhere strictly to your physician's instructions; it may be taken with or without food, but consistent timing optimizes effectiveness. Exceeding the prescribed dosage can be detrimental. If a dose is missed, take it promptly upon recollection. Complete the entire course, even with symptom improvement; premature cessation may reduce its efficacy. Common side effects include nausea, vomiting, diarrhea, and dyspepsia. Worsening side effects warrant immediate medical attention. Allergic reactions (rash, itching, swelling, dyspnea) necessitate prompt medical help. Inform your doctor of all current medications before commencing treatment. Pregnant or lactating individuals require prior medical consultation. Alcohol consumption should be avoided due to potential increased drowsiness. While typically non-impairing to driving ability, refrain from driving if drowsiness or dizziness occurs. Adequate rest, nutrition, and hydration promote faster recovery. Your doctor may order blood tests to monitor the medication's effects.

How Bdxime-O Tablet works:

Bdxime-O tablets contain Cefixime and Ofloxacin, two antibiotics acting synergistically. Cefixime inhibits bacterial cell wall synthesis, a crucial process for bacterial survival. Ofloxacin interferes with bacterial DNA replication and repair. This combined action provides comprehensive infection control.

SAFETY ADVICE

AlcoholAlcoholUNSAFE

Concurrent alcohol use and Bdxime-O Tablet is inadvisable.

PregnancyPregnancyCONSULT YOUR DOCTOR

The use of Bdxime-O Tablet during pregnancy may pose risks. While human research is scarce, animal studies indicate potential harm to a developing fetus. A physician will assess the potential advantages against possible risks prior to prescribing. Physician consultation is advised.

Breast feedingBreast feedingCONSULT YOUR DOCTOR

The use of Bdxime-O Tablets while breastfeeding is likely inadvisable. Available human data indicates a potential for the medication to transfer to breast milk, posing a risk to the infant.

DrivingDrivingUNSAFE

Taking Bdxime-O Tablets might reduce attentiveness, impair vision, and cause drowsiness or dizziness. Driving should be avoided if these effects are experienced.

KidneyKidneyCAUTION

Patients with kidney impairment should use Bdxime-O Tablets cautiously, potentially requiring a modified dosage. Physician consultation is advised.

LiverLiverCAUTION

Patients with hepatic impairment should exercise caution when using Bdxime-O Tablets. Dosage modification may be necessary; physician consultation is advised.

What if you forget to take Bdxime-O Tablet :

Should you forget to take a Bdxime-O Tablet, administer it immediately. Nevertheless, if your next scheduled dose is imminent, omit the missed dose and resume your usual dosing regimen. Avoid taking a double dose.

FAQs on Bdxime-O Tablet

Continue taking Bdxime-O Tablet as prescribed, completing the entire course even if you feel better. Full recovery requires finishing all medication, as symptoms may subside before the infection is fully eradicated.
If you miss a dose of Bdxime-O Tablet, take it as soon as you remember, unless it's nearly time for your next dose. Never double up on doses.
Bdxime-O Tablet can cause diarrhea as a side effect. This is because, while it eliminates harmful bacteria as an antibiotic, it also impacts beneficial gut bacteria. Consult your doctor if you experience severe diarrhea.
Contact your doctor if your symptoms worsen during treatment or persist after completing the prescribed course.
Bdxime-O Tablets are recommended for treating urinary tract infections (UTIs).
Complete your antibiotic course as directed, avoiding missed doses to ensure faster infection resolution. Improve personal hygiene, and always urinate before and after sexual intercourse. Adequate water intake helps flush bacteria; thoroughly empty your bladder each time you urinate.
Bdxime-O Tablets may cause drowsiness, dizziness, or vision changes. Avoid driving or operating machinery until you understand the medication's effects on you.
Store this medication in its original, tightly closed container, following the storage instructions on the label. Discard any unused medication; keep it out of reach of children, pets, and others.
